Research advances in biosurfactant remediation of hydrophobic organicscontaminated soil.

Abstract: In this paper, the hazards of hydrophobic organic contaminants (HOCs) accumulation in soil environment and the advantages of applying biosurfactants in the remediation of HOCs-contaminated soil were briefly introduced, the main remediation mechanism of biosurfactants, i.e., promoting the dissolution, desorption, and biodegradation of HOCs was elucidated, and the effects of the type and concentration of biosurfactants and the physical and chemical properties of soils on the remediation were analyzed. The prospects of the application and development of biosurfactants in the remediation of HOCscontaminated soil were also discussed.
